Coming Out of the Dark: A Memoir of DID, Self-Acceptance, and Healing | Pat Suzie Tennent
1 post | 1 read
A powerful memoir of ongoing recovery from catastrophic abuse. Pat's book details her life with trauma-induced Dissociative Identity Disorder, and the incredible love which is helping her to heal from her past.As a child, Pat was subject to horrendous abuse by those who should have protected her. As a powerful defence against this, her mind split into differing personalities, which served to shield her from her worst memories. As her life has progressed, Pat has worked with great courage to heal from past traumas, and develop communication between her personalities. Along the way, her own fortitude and the love of some wonderful women have been integral to her healing process.This is not the story of how a child was abused - it is the story of how an adult can come to terms with a past literally too dreadful to contemplate, and how love and compassion can work recovery miracles.

For anyone that wants to understand DID or the impact of trauma either being a survivor of abuse or a therapist working in this area I cant rate this book highly enough. The book looks more at recovery and the obstacles survivors face daily rather than going into the abuse itself.

DID is still misrepresented by media and this book shows the real world for someone who is a multiple
